In Japan in particular, Fall/Autumn is a time when we welcome the cooler temperatures and embrace the beautiful warm colours that we find in nature. Hikers venture off into the countryside to enjoy their adventures and surround themselves with the abundance of majestic mountains that are very much a part of Japan’s natural beauty. Onsen’s too draw people away from the city to immerse themselves in the healing hot waters of Japan’s volcanic land.
